Asian Chicken Stroganoff

  • Servings: 6
  • Prep: 15m
  • Cook: 9-10m
  • The following recipe serves 6 people.

Ingredients

The ingredients are:
  • 2 tablespoons oil (vegetable oil)
  • 1 medium yellow onion (thinly sliced)
  • 140 grams fresh mushrooms (about 2 cups whole, then quartered)
  • 2 to 3 garlic clove, minced
  • 1 pound boneless skinless chicken breast (cut into strips, or turkey strips)
  • 1 cup chicken broth (divided)
  • 3 tablespoons hoisin sauce
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ce
  • 1 teaspoon chili garlic sauce (or adjust to heat level)
  • 1 cup sour cream (low-fat is okay, do not use fat-free)
  • 2 tablespoons corn starch
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

How to Make

  • Step 1: In a large skillet heat oil and add onion, mushrooms and garlic. Cook over medium-high heat for 3-4 minutes or until onions are tender. Remove from pan and set aside.

  • Step 2: Add chicken strips to skillet and cook 4 minutes. Stir in cooked onion, mushrooms and garlic. Add 3/4 cup of broth, hoisin sauce, soy sauce and chili garlic sauce, stir to combine and cook 5 minutes.

  • Step 3: In a small bowl, combine remaining 1/4 cup broth and cornstarch and stir into mixture; heat to boiling and cook stirring about 1 - 1 1/2 minutes or until thickened. Remove from heat and stir in sour cream. Season with salt and pepper. Serve over rice or egg noodles.
